问题描述
|
QTabWidget的信号currentChanged()。并返回当前
标签页的索引。
但是如何
在这样的表达式中
获取此参数:
tabs.currentChanged.connect(lambda: foo());
def foo(index):
...
我应该在哪里寻找刚刚返回的参数?
解决方法
信号不“返回”任何东西。但是,它们可以具有参数,例如
currentIndex
。如果要将该参数传递给函数,则应尝试:
tabs.currentChanged.connect(lambda index: foo(index));